MISSISSAUGA, Ontario — Sharon Driscoll has joined Katz Group Canada Ltd., the operator of the Rexall and Rexall Pharma Plus pharmacy chains, as executive vice president and chief financial officer.

Sharon Driscoll

Katz said Monday that Driscoll most recently served as senior vice president of finance and CFO at Sears Canada Inc.

In coming to the Rexall chain, she brings with over 25 years in strategic financial leadership in the retail sector, Katz noted. Before joining Sears, she held several senior-level positions at Loblaw Cos., including senior vice president of corporate development.

"Sharon’s more than two decades of retail leadership experience will make her a tremendous addition to the Rexall management team," Frank Scorpiniti, chief executive officer of Katz Group Canada, said in a statement.

"Throughout her career, Sharon has demonstrated a capacity to identify strategic growth opportunities as well as the ability to achieve efficiencies, and we are excited to have her continue that record of success as a member of our team," he added.

The chain drug retailer has 426 Rexall and Rexall Pharma Plus pharmacies across Canada.
